Abstract
⺠Results show that off-farm work tends to decrease fertilizer/chemical expenses. ⺠Chemical usage decrease significantly at the higher percentiles of the distribution. ⺠The study finds a positive effect of crop insurance on chemical usage. ⺠The effect of crop insurance on chemical usage is robust across entire distribution.
